The information in this section refers to materials restricted by regulation or law and applies to parts,
components and products sold by HP. This product does not contain:
- Asbestos
- Cadmium as a stabilizer, coloring agent or surface coating treatment. The total concentration of
cadmium in any part, component or material in this product is £50 mg/kg.
- Lead carbonates or sulfates are not contained in any paint applied.
- Mercury (except lamps containing less than 10 mg)
- Chlorofluorocarbons (CFCs), halons, HCFCs, HBFCs, 1,1,1 trichloroethane, carbon tetrachloride or
methyl bromide.
- Chlorinated or brominated dioxins or furans are not present at a concentration that is currently
prohibited by law.
- Polychlorinated biphenyls (PCB) or polychlorinated terphenyls (PCT).

Packaging
- Packaging materials do not contain lead, mercury, cadmium or hexavalent chromium as an
intentionally added element. The sum concentration of incidental lead, mercury, cadmium and
hexavalent chromium in the packaging for this product is less than 100mg/kg.
- No chlorofluorocarbons (CFCs), halons, HCFCs, HBFCs, 1,1,1 trichloroethane, carbon tetrachloride
or methyl bromide are used in plastic foam packaging materials.
- Plastic packaging materials are marked according to ISO 11469 and DIN 6120 standards.
External:
Corrugated paper Weight: 19 kg
Internal:
Polystyrene-Foam Weight: 2,5 kg
100% recycled timber (pallet) Weight 26 Kg
HP designs packaging to be recyclable where practical. The recyclability of the packaging depends
on the availability of municipal recycling programs for the packaging used.
